Kannada-English dictionary
: Alar: Kannada-English corpusNiḥkala (ನಿಃಕ�):—[adjective] complete; whole; perfect.
--- OR ---
Niḥkala (ನಿಃಕ�):—[noun] the Absolute Being; the God.
